Just implemented my first (very painful) Ex 07 CCR system.

 

You will need at least 3 servers:  1 for the CAS/HT/File Share Witness, 2
for the Windows Cluster/Exchange Cluster

I have a customer interested in migrating their Windows 2003/Exchange 2003
FE/BE environment into a W2K8/E2K7 Cluster (for the mailboxes only).  As
this is not my usual area of expertise, I would appreciate any advice you
have to offer.

 

My thoughts are that we need two new servers to make up the CCR cluster and
the E2K7 MBOX servers.  From what I can tell, CCR is not a Windows cluster,
but an Exchange thing, so I don't need to worry about quorums and the like.
The existing FE would be upgraded to an E2K7 CAS. 

 

I guess my question is, what happens to the other roles?  There are only 500
users or so and things run really well on two servers now.  They aren't
really interested in an Edge server, but obviously the Hub Transport role
(and maybe an internal CAS) needs to go somewhere.  They can run on the CCR,
right?
